WAR ITEMS
The British War Office announces a further list of eight names of Üboat prisoners.
The British community in the Argentine has despatched £20,000 to the British Patriotic Fund. To date the donations from the British community in the Argentine have totalled £60,000, and another £60,000 is promised.
Already between 2000 and 3000 Britons have volunteered in London for service in Finland.
During the first 11 weeks of the British national savings campaign over £80,000,000 was raised, which was nearly four times the anticipated rate.
